Transaction 320af595388e0e61b43ba24a714d5fd8cf3ed387713bcdd04df77e7392538309
1 Input
1 Output
-
320af595388e0e61b43ba24a714d5fd8cf3ed387713bcdd04df77e7392538309:0
- value
- 5789
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 54a9b5d1a969a4b71c4cedb89325a526d6a2f998 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18if4nfSHxktdw42iYgUH8A9HpSEXhHJGt